This government tender offers a significant opportunity for experienced civil engineering and pipeline contractors to participate in a large-scale water infrastructure project in Gujarat. The project involves the supply, manufacturing, and laying of 1016 mm OD spiral submerged ARC welded M.S. pipes, adhering to IS:3589-2001 standards. Managed by Surat Municipal Corporation, the project aims to upgrade water transmission infrastructure from the Valak Intake Well at Simada to Vishwakarma Junction near the 82 MLD Water Treatment Plant at Magob. With an estimated cost of ₹162.27 crore, this tender emphasizes quality, safety, and timely completion. Bidders must meet strict eligibility criteria, including technical experience, financial stability, and document submission. The process involves transparent online bidding, with detailed evaluation based on technical competence, past experience, and cost-effectiveness. Scope Of Work

The scope of work includes:

  • Manufacturing and supply of 1016 mm OD spiral submerged ARC welded M.S. pipes as per IS:3589-2001 standards.
  • Laying of pipes along the designated route from Valak Intake Well to Vishwakarma Junction.
  • Installation of pipeline components including joints, fittings, and supports.
  • Testing and commissioning of the water main to ensure leak-proof and efficient operation.

The key deliverables are:

  • Supply of high-quality pipes meeting specified standards.
  • Proper installation with adherence to safety and quality norms.
  • Complete documentation and testing reports.

The process involves:

  1. Preparation and mobilization at the site.
  2. Manufacturing of pipes as per technical specifications.
  3. Transporting pipes to the project site.
  4. Laying and jointing of pipes following approved methods.
  5. Hydrostatic testing to verify integrity.
  6. Final inspection and handover.

Eligibility Criteria

Bidders must fulfill the following eligibility requirements:

  • ✓ Must have valid registration and licenses for pipeline construction and civil works.
  • ✓ Must submit Scan Copy of Tender Fee (₹21,240) and Scan Copy of EMD as per tender instructions.
  • ✓ Must provide all required documents as specified, including technical and financial credentials.
  • ✓ Experience in executing similar large-diameter pipeline projects (minimum of 2 projects worth over ₹50 crore in the last 5 years).
  • ✓ Financial stability demonstrated by annual turnover of at least ₹100 crore in the last three financial years.
Qualification Criteria Minimum Requirement
Tender Fee Submission Yes
EMD Submission Yes
Past Experience ≥ 2 similar projects
Annual Turnover ≥ ₹100 crore

All submitted documents must be valid, clear, and conform to tender specifications to qualify for further evaluation.
